Applications
Chemical name: Bacterioruberin, CAS 32719-43-0, is a natural carotenoid pigment with a deep red color, commonly used as a natural colorant and antioxidant in cosmetics and personal care; used as a pigment in coatings and inks; employed as a colorant and potential stabilizer in polymers and plastics; and is being evaluated for industrial manufacturing applications to improve optical stability and colorfastness of colorant systems.
